Tsuga canadensis Cole’s Prostrate
Tsuga canadensis ‘Cole’s Prostrate’ is a classic ground-hugging form of eastern hemlock selected for its low, spreading habit and graceful, trailing branches. Rather than growing upright, this cultivar creeps outward, forming a soft evergreen carpet that drapes naturally over slopes or walls. Its flowing form highlights the species’ fine texture at ground level. It grows best in partial shade with cool, evenly moist, well-drained soil and develops at a slow to moderate pace. Hardy in USDA Zones 3–7, it is ideal for woodland edges, slopes, and naturalistic landscapes where a horizontal evergreen accent is desired.
